First and foremost, having the best tools is important. A high-quality digicam body combined with versatile lenses is a foundation each wedding photographer should invest in. Typically, professionals opt for a full-frame digital digicam that allows them to carry out in varied lighting conditions. Having lenses ranging from wide-angle to telephoto becomes important, as this range aids in capturing every little thing from expansive venue photographs to intimate close-ups of the couple.


Another essential element is having a backup plan. Weddings are unpredictable, and things can generally go wrong. Having a second digital camera, extra batteries, and memory playing cards prevents potential disasters. This backup gear ought to be readily accessible throughout the day, providing peace of mind for both the photographer and the couple.




Light plays a significant position in photography, particularly for weddings. Understanding natural gentle is significant, because it supplies essentially the most flattering and romantic tones. Photographers ought to scout the venue beforehand to determine the most effective mild sources and how they shift throughout the day. Additionally, carrying artificial lighting equipment, such as flash units or reflectors, may help when pure mild isn't sufficient.

Attire is one other wedding photography essential typically ignored. Photographers should gown appropriately to mix in with the wedding visitors, in addition to for consolation. Weddings can require long hours on one's toes, so opting for comfy yet skilled clothes helps keep power throughout the day. Wearing dark colors can additionally be useful, as they don’t distract from the couple or the event’s ambiance.


Communication is essential, both earlier than and through the wedding. Having pre-wedding consultations permits couples to precise their interests, style, and any must-have photographs. This dialogue is crucial in making certain that the photographer captures the couple’s imaginative and prescient. Maintaining open communication all through the event enables the photographer to adjust to the couple’s preferences seamlessly.
